How Pre-Trial Probation in Texas: How to Maintain a Clean Record Actually Works
Pre-trial probation is a legal agreement that allows an individual to complete a period of supervision before a trial concludes. Rather than remaining in custody or facing immediate penalties, the court offers a chance to demonstrate responsibility. This process typically involves conditions such as regular check-ins with a probation officer, mandated counseling, or community service. The primary goal is rehabilitation and ensuring court appearances. If the terms are met successfully, the original charges may be reduced or dismissed. It is important to view this as a structured opportunity rather than a guaranteed outcome. Success depends entirely on compliance and engagement with the assigned requirements.
Common Questions People Have About Pre-Trial Probation in Texas: How to Maintain a Clean Record
Individuals often wonder about the duration of the probation period and its impact on their daily life. Length can vary based on the judgeโs discretion and the nature of the case. Some might question whether they can travel or maintain employment during this time. Generally, travel requires prior approval, and maintaining a job is often encouraged to show stability. Another frequent concern involves failure to comply. If a condition is violated, consequences can include stricter terms or the reinstatement of original charges. Understanding these boundaries is essential for navigating the process effectively and minimizing stress.

Things People Often Misunderstand
A widespread myth is that pre-trial probation is a "slap on the wrist" with no real consequences. In reality, it is a serious judicial tool that demands strict adherence. Another misconception is that it automatically erases your record. While it can prevent a conviction, the arrest may still appear on background checks unless expungement is pursued later. Some believe that once on probation, they have no further obligations. This is inaccurate; consistent communication with the probation officer is mandatory. Clearing up these points builds trust and helps individuals take the process seriously. Knowledge is the most powerful tool for compliance.
